Oh, You WILL Pay B.G.

As my homie Haze from DGB put it, this is one of those tracks you don’t see everyday. With B.G.’s seemingly 50th studio album, Too Hood 2 Be Hollywood, hitting stores next week, one of my more anticipated tracks has finally surfaced. You see, the track features Soulja Slim, C-Murder and Lil Boosie, making it one of the rare occasions where all off the featured artists are either dead or in jail, unfortunately.

Equip with a Soulja Slim hook from the record from he and B.G.’s “Owe Me Some Money“, Gizzle trades bars with two of the south’s more infamous rhymers. Bittersweet, in a sense. Appreciate what you have have while it’s here.

FYI, the album hits stores December 8 along with Clipse, Snoop and Gucci. Hope you have your gift cards ready. You already know how I feel about that day.
